Motorbike Height: 

If you’re looking for the 125 CC motorbike for short women, you’ll probably see the height first.

Ideally, it would be best to have a motorbike where you can easily reach your feet to the ground to balance it uphill and downhill. 

It would be best to choose a motorbike with a seat height of less than 30 inches to ride it comfortably. But if you’re a professional rider who can handle tall motorbikes, you can go with any motorbike.

Motorbike Weight: 

Motorbike weight is the only factor that no one usually talks about. Still, it plays a crucial role in managing and handling the motorbike at a higher speed. 

If you’re short, you should go with a motorbike with the least overall weight so that you can easily handle the motorbike without feeling embarrassed. 

If you’re choosing a motorbike with low CC, it’s likely a lightweight one for casual riding. 

Motorbike Weight Distribution: 

You can’t change the motorbike weight, but you surely can go with a motorbike that comes with a uniformly uniform design motorbike so that the motorbike weight distributes perfectly. 

Good motorbike weight distribution motorbike is highly stable. It can’t be imbalanced while taking a sharp turn at a higher speed, you can know a motorbike with a good weight distribution by simply test-driving the motorbike. 

Or better, ask the dealer to show the motorbike with the best weight distribution ratio. 

Handlebar and Seat Position: 

Indeed the uniform weight distribution should also be on your priority factor list, but do you know that handlebar and seat position also plays a crucial role in choosing the motorbike? 

Ideally, you should choose the motorbike with the neutral position seat and handlebar, which puts your wrist and shoulder in the neutral position, especially if you plan long riding. 

To avoid any medical conditions, choosing motorbikes with neutral handlebars and seat positions would be best.
